A SOUTH ITALIAN CARVED AND GILT-VARNISHED (MECCA) DECORATED OVERMANTEL MIRROR
MID-18TH CENTURY, PROBABLY NAPLES, ORIGINALLY PART OF A BOISERIE
Of shaped rectangular form, with foliate shaped cresting, and rectangular mirror panels, minor losses and replacements, rebacked
76¼ in. (194 cm.) high; 55½ in. (141 cm.) wide
